Internal Memo — Proposed Sale of the Halverton Unit

To the Board: management has completed its review of the Halverton Instrumentation unit and recommends proceeding with a sale. The unit contributes modest revenue but requires capital investment we cannot justify against core priorities. Two credible acquirers have signed confidentiality undertakings; diligence could begin within six weeks. Employee communications will follow a sequenced plan reviewed by counsel. The confidential terms under consideration are set out below.

internal memo for faweg-tafog: Only 7 of the 100 pilot accounts renewed Quenael, so a churn review is set for April 15.

TICKET-4417: Signature check failing on lingua-extract

The translation-string extraction script (lingua-extract) fails CI with a bad signature on the bundled parser wheel. This started after the Quellmark mirror rotated its artifacts. New folks: don't bypass with --no-verify; that flag is banned in the Thornfield pipeline. Re-pin the wheel hash, re-run extraction, and confirm the .po output diff is empty. The correct key to verify against is as follows.

release key, hadug-kawef: bky13_mPGeFZeR1GZ1G

## Environments

Datemint handles all locale-aware date rendering for the Corvid Analytics dashboards. Each environment — sandbox, staging, and production — applies its own locale fallback chain and format catalog version. As a contractor, you'll mostly work in sandbox. Before running the formatter locally, apply the environment settings shown below:

config for bahop-fajep:
DRUATH_PIN=4501
DRUATH_TENANT=briwyn
DRUATH_METRICS_HOST=metrics.druath.brasksoft.test
DRUATH_SEAL=seal_7d2e069d
DRUATH_STANDBY_TEAM=olieth